Funded by the Provost’s Office, Office of Diversity, Equity and Inclusion (ODEI), and the School of Social Work, the Social Work and Arts Collaboratory aims to provide resources for scholars, students, and community members to engage in collaborative approaches to advance social justice and antiracism research.
